Abstract

The present invention discloses a method for push operation of motor vehicle equipped with drive unit. The method comprises the following steps: in the push operation of the motor vehicle, at a first group engine rotation speed and transmission gear, reducing speed through enlarging the opening degree of an engine throttle and jointing the transmission with the engine through a clutch; and at a second group engine rotation speed and transmission gear, separating the transmission from the engine through clutch separation for reducing speed, wherein the first group engine rotation speed and transmission gear is different form the second group engine rotation speed and transmission gear.

Background technology
Due to the restriction of the deposit of fossil/fossil energy, particularly owing to obtaining the limited availability of the oil of the raw material running fuel needed for explosive motor, in explosive motor evolution, drop into continuous effort to minimize consumption of fuel.On the one hand, the prospect of these effort is to improve, namely more effective, burning.And on the other hand, the specific policy about explosive motor basic operation is also actv..
The idea improving fuel consumption in vehicles comprises, and such as, if do not have instantaneous power demand, then closes explosive motor, instead of makes it run continuously in the idling state.In practice, this means at least to close explosive motor when vehicle stops.A utilization of this idea is exactly, such as, and the traffic that stops and goes occurred when express highway and backbone highway occur to block.In the traffic in urban district, owing to there is the result of the traffic signal lamp system do not coordinated mutually, the traffic that stops and goes is no longer exception and becomes rule.Limited junction railway and so on provides further example.
For the consumption of fuel strategy reducing explosive motor taxiing operation (now not having instantaneous power demands equally), there is similar departure point and combine the concept of aforementioned type equally.
The strategy of all reduction taxiing operation consumption of fuels is all delivered to the general way of the lock torque of transmission system based on explosive motor when being reduced in taxiing operation, reduces slow down and extend the distance can be passed through caused due to vehicle energy from given car speed v with this.Because in taxiing operation, fuel supply is closed usually, namely be stopped, so the increase of distance along with taxiing operation process, total consumption of fuel of vehicle is lowered, and this is because consumption of fuel is calculated by the fuel quantity that uses and the distance passed through under this fuel quantity.Such as, but be different from aforementioned idea, explosive motor is not closed but continues to run, idle.
In the present invention, traditional taxiing operation is understood to the running state of explosive motor or vehicle, and in this condition, power-transfer clutch closes, and namely engages, and there is not loading demand; That is, chaufeur does not have actuating accelerator pedal.In the present invention, the common ground of various taxiing operation there is not loading demand.
According to prior art, the throttle gate be arranged in inlet channel is closed completely when taxiing operation, therefore due to piston sustained oscillation, creates negative pressure in the downstream of throttle gate, which results in the pump gas of so-called explosive motor.Consequently need to perform extra inflation exchange work.This inflation exchange work defines the pith of the lock torque being delivered to transmission system when taxiing operation from explosive motor.
A kind of strategy reducing consumption of fuel when taxiing operation, it is equally at Automobiltechnische Zeitschrift, within 1999, No. 9 438 pages are described, and this strategy proposes the cut-off clutch when taxiing operation and thus reasonable match other parts is separated.The deceleration of power actuated vehicle is lowered in this way, this is because as hindering factor, the lock torque being usually delivered to vehicle when taxiing operation by explosive motor is eliminated.Along with disengaging of clutch, therefore car retardation determines primarily of rolling resistance and air resistance.But the prerequisite that this strategy is implemented is can the power-transfer clutch of self actuating, namely activates by electronic control system and does not need driver to participate in the power-transfer clutch of (namely performing)
Although for determining that the driving cycle that consumption of fuel specifies generally includes the decelerating phase, this decelerating phase needs the actuating of car brakeing owing to needing larger deceleration gradient, and is therefore unsuitable for the strategy reducing the consumption of fuel of explosive motor when taxiing operation by reducing lock torque.But it is more and more frequent that the decelerating phase being feature with little deceleration gradient in the highway communication of reality occurs, and a class strategy is hereafter discussed is used in fuel saving in above-mentioned situation.

By the method for the taxiing operation of the power actuated vehicle for equipping actuating device and drg, the first object of the present invention is implemented, and wherein drg is activated by brake pedal.This actuating device comprises explosive motor and has can the change-speed box of power-transfer clutch of self actuating, and explosive motor has fuel supply system to unify at least one inlet channel of supplied fresh air, throttle gate is placed in inlet channel, wherein, pass through electronic control system, with the function of engine speed n and the instant Transmission gear m selected, reduce the deceleration of power actuated vehicle in taxiing operation, wherein in the first operational mode, by regulating throttle gate in open position direction, or in the second operational mode, pass through cut-off clutch, the output valve that the operational mode adopted maps as the input-output being stored in control system is read, and engine speed n and Transmission gear m is used as input value.
In this innovative approach, deceleration when betiding taxiing operation is by a reduction in two possible processes, actual adopted process is determined by engine speed n and Transmission gear m, and be under the boundary condition existed in two processes on fuel consumption perspective better process.
For reducing by first possible process of slowing down during taxiing operation, it is also called as the first operational mode under taxiing operation background, is provided in the direction adjustment throttle gate of open position.
Contrary with method of the prior art, in the method according to the invention, the throttle gate be arranged in inlet channel is not close completely or keep to close when taxiing operation, but opens with width more or less.When piston sustained oscillation, throttle gate open the formation negative pressure counteracted in throttle gate downstream, decrease the energy dissipation of burn engine because gas exchanges produces.As the result of this measure, the lock torque being delivered to transmission system and vehicle by explosive motor is eliminated.Thus the deceleration of self-propelled vehicle is reduced, and therefore, under the condition that car speed is identical, power actuated vehicle can move longer distance.Consumption of fuel is lowered.
During taxiing operation, reduce the process that the second of car retardation is possible, it is also called as the second operational mode under taxiing operation background, provides cut-off clutch and is separated the remainder of explosive motor and transmission system.To put on the process of lock torque on transmission system and vehicle contrary with only reducing driving engine according to the first operational mode, according to the second operational mode, in the operational process of explosive motor, the lock torque that explosive motor applies thoroughly is eliminated as hindering factor.
Under all operations condition, any one in two described processes is more superior unlike another at fuel consumption perspective.When taxiing operation, the one reduced in aforementioned two kinds of means of car retardation use is identified and fixes in the first treatment step.In this case, read by the operational mode used from the input-output being stored in electronic control system maps.
It is that vehicle is specific that input-output maps, and can produce by experiment on test cell, or is mathematically produced by the means of emulation.Engine speed n and Transmission gear m is used as input value to read by the operational mode used.It should be noted that other operational factor of hypothesis driven device and vehicle, such as car speed v, can from mentioned two operational factors, namely derive in engine speed n and Transmission gear m, then this operational factor also can be used as input value.The operational mode used under institute's current operating condition is better one at fuel consumption perspective.Being stored in three-dimensional input-output mappings in control system can be with, and such as, the form of multiple queries table stores.

Detailed description of the invention
Fig. 1 show schematically show the diagram of circuit of the process steps of first embodiment of this method.
Enforcement due to method needs taxiing operation state, and this prerequisite is tested in the process first step.If vehicle is not in traditional taxiing operation state, so the method terminates.
From traditional taxiing operation state of power actuated vehicle, whether brake pedal activated detected.The actuating of brake pedal is assessed as the demand increasing car retardation, and the action that vehicle is switched to the first operational mode or the second operational mode in the case can not perform, this is because it can cause the reduction of car retardation, the requirement of this and chaufeur is runed counter to.And according to the actuating of brake pedal, vehicle is switched to traditional taxiing operation, or continue to start to run in traditional taxiing operation of place supposition in such as this method, wherein engaged the and throttle gate of power-transfer clutch is closed.
But, if brake pedal does not activated, then suppose that the deceleration of vehicle can be reduced to reduce consumption of fuel.
Therefore, vehicle by electronic control system automatically, namely without the need to chaufeur pro-active intervention ground, is transformed into the first operational mode or the second operational mode.
First the operational mode of place in operation is read as the output valve mapped from the input-output stored in the controls, for this purpose, must be determined as the engine speed n of input value and Transmission gear m.Under current operating condition, the actual operational mode used is more favourable on fuel consumption perspective.
The first operational mode for reducing the deceleration in taxiing operation is provided in open position direction and regulates throttle gate.That is, the feature of the first operational mode is the throttle gate opened.
The second operational mode for reducing the deceleration in taxiing operation provides cut-off clutch to be separated with the remainder of transmission system to make explosive motor.That is, the feature of the second operational mode is the power-transfer clutch of separation.
From the one in aforementioned two kinds of operational modes, once brake pedal activated, vehicle is just switched in traditional taxiing operation.In traditional taxiing operation, can continue to refresh the test activated brake pedal, once no longer continue the actuating of brake pedal, then be transformed into immediately according to the one in two kinds of operational modes of the present invention.
According to an aspect of the present invention, a kind of method of taxiing operation of the power actuated vehicle for having explosive motor is provided.This method comprises: in first group of engine speed and Transmission gear, utilizes and increases opening and joining change-speed box to driving engine to reduce deceleration by power-transfer clutch of engine air throttle; And in second group of engine speed and Transmission gear, by disengaging of clutch, change-speed box is separated to reduce deceleration with driving engine, wherein first group of engine speed and Transmission gear are different from second group of engine speed and Transmission gear.First group of engine speed and Transmission gear can be referred to as the first operational mode, and second group of engine speed and Transmission gear can be referred to as the second operational mode.
According to engine speed and Transmission gear, electronic control system can determine that with a first operation mode or the second operational mode runs taxiing operation state.Such as, the input-output be stored in electronic control system maps and can be used for making decision.In input-output maps, operational mode is the function of engine speed n and Transmission gear m.In one example, first group of engine speed n1 and Transmission gear m1 corresponds to the first operational mode, and second group of engine speed n2 and Transmission gear m2 corresponds to the second operational mode.It should be noted that, the first operational mode and the second operational mode can engine speed within the scope of corresponding one and Transmission gear.In addition, it should be noted that, engine speed n1 can equal engine speed n2 and Transmission gear ml can equal Transmission gear m2, but the combination of first group of engine speed and Transmission gear is different from the combination of second group of engine speed and Transmission gear.
It can be that vehicle is specific that input-output maps, and can produce by experiment on test cell, or is mathematically produced by the means of emulation.It should be noted that other operational factor of hypothesis driven device and vehicle, such as car speed v, can from mentioned two operational factors, namely derive in engine speed n and Transmission gear m, then this operational factor also can be used as input value.Replaceable, being stored in three-dimensional input-output mappings in control system can be with, and such as, the form of multiple queries table stores.
In one embodiment, in first group of engine speed and Transmission gear, the fuel supply of explosive motor is stopped.In another embodiment, in second group of engine speed and Transmission gear, explosive motor runs on idling mode.In yet another embodiment, in first group of engine speed and Transmission gear, because the actuating throttle gate of brake pedal is closed, and power-transfer clutch is engaged.In yet another embodiment, in second group of engine speed and Transmission gear, because the actuated clutches of brake pedal is engaged, and throttle gate is closed.
